Sat 1780154612380151

decimal
584123.862380151
degree
0°164123′1499″862380151‴
percentile
84.7692673494439%
name
bfwphnfdefi
cycle
0
epoch
2
period
289
block
584123
offset
862380151
timestamp
rarity
common